However, you should know that it is not a good idea to remove citations or information sourced through citations simply because a link to a source is not working, as you did to Jeremy Lin. Dead links should not be deleted. Instead, please repair or replace the link, if possible, and ensure properly sourced information is retained. Often, a live substitute link can be found. Links not used as references, notes or citations are not as important, such as those listed in the "External links" or "Further reading" sections, but bad links in those sections should also be fixed if possible.
